Silvaplana (Romansh: ) is a municipality in the Maloja Region in the Swiss canton of the Grisons and the name of a lake in the municipality.

==History== thumb|left|upright|Village church in Silvaplana The first sign of a settlement in the borders of the municipality is some Roman-era broken pillars on the Julier Pass. The village church was first mentioned in 1356. A new, late gothic church was built in 1491. In 1556 the village converted to the Protestant Reformation.
